Notes
--> India innings: 50 in 20.4 overs, 101 minutes
--> India innings: 100 in 36.1 overs, 178 minutes
--> Australia innings: 50 in 13.5 overs, 71 minutes
--> N Chopra made his debut in Australia in List A matches
--> N Chopra made his debut in Australia in ODI matches
--> DJ Gandhi made his debut in Australia in List A matches
--> DJ Gandhi made his debut in Australia in ODI matches
--> A Symonds achieved his best innings bowling analysis in ODI matches when he dismissed BKV Prasad in the India innings (previous best was 3-34)
--> GD McGrath reached 150 wickets in ODI matches when he dismissed SR Tendulkar, his 1st wicket in the India innings
12th Men: SCG MacGill (Aus) and HH Kanitkar (Ind)
Indian innings finished at 5:30pm, meaning there was a 10 minute break for a change of innings, and then 20 minutes of play until the dinner break was taken at 6:00pm
Dinner: Australia 12/0 (Gilchrist 8*, ME Waugh 1*, 5 overs)
Rain stopped play from 7:12pm to 7:38pm. There was no adjustment to the overs.
Attendance: 38,831
